Scrapy is a powerful and flexible web scraping framework written in Python. It allows you to easily extract data from websites and save it in a structured format. One of the key components in Scrapy is the Item class.

The Item class is used to define the structure of the data that you want to extract from a website. It acts as a container to hold the scraped data. In this blog post, we will walk through the process of defining and using the Item class in Scrapy.

Creating the Scrapy Item class

To create a Scrapy Item class, you need to define it as a subclass of scrapy.Item. Here’s an example of how you can define a simple Item class:

import scrapy

class BookItem(scrapy.Item):
    title = scrapy.Field()
    author = scrapy.Field()
    price = scrapy.Field()

In the above code, we define a BookItem class that inherits from scrapy.Item. Inside the class, we define three fields: title, author, and price. These fields represent the attributes of the item that we want to scrape from a website.

Using the Scrapy Item class

Once you have defined the Item class, you can use it within a Scrapy spider to extract data from web pages. Here’s an example of how to utilize the BookItem class in a spider:

import scrapy

class BookSpider(scrapy.Spider):
    name = "books"
    start_urls = [
        "http://books.example.com"
    ]

    def parse(self, response):
        for book in response.xpath("//div[@class='book']"):
            item = BookItem()
            item['title'] = book.xpath(".//h2/text()").get()
            item['author'] = book.xpath(".//span[@class='author']/text()").get()
            item['price'] = book.xpath(".//span[@class='price']/text()").get()
            yield item

In this example, we have a BookSpider that starts scraping from a given URL. Inside the parse method, we iterate through each book element on the page and create a new instance of the BookItem class. We then extract the values for each field using XPath selectors and assign them to the corresponding item attributes. Finally, we yield the item to pass it to the Scrapy pipeline for further processing.
